The following lists slang borrowings from the Nguni Bantu languages (which include Zulu and Xhosa).They typically occur in use in South Africa's townships, but some have become increasingly popular among white youth.Unless otherwise noted these words do not occur in formal South African English.. abba - the act of carrying a child on you back. Auntie is used frequently in countries such as India and throughout Africa, where age signifies dignity and the elderly are considered an asset to the community rather than a … In Durban and other parts of South Africa, Aunty and Uncle are commonly used among Indians along with their ethnic kinship terms.
